Spec comparison
| Spec | Yamaha DT 125 R | Honda NX 125 Trans City |
|---|---|---|
| Model year | 2002 | 2000 |
| Price | — | — |
| Engine | 124 cc | 124 cc |
| Horsepower | 14 hp | 13 hp |
| Torque | 14 Nm | 12 Nm |
| Weight | 116 kg | 120 kg |
| Seat height | 35 mm | 34 mm |
| Fuel type | petrol | petrol |
| Transmission | — | 6-speed |
| Front brakes | Single disc | Single disc |
| Rear brakes | Single disc | Expanding brake |
Yamaha DT 125 R vs Honda NX 125 Trans City — which should you buy?
Picking between the Yamaha DT 125 R and the Honda NX 125 Trans City usually comes down to the numbers you care about most. On paper, the Yamaha DT 125 R brings 14 hp in a 116 kg package, while the Honda NX 125 Trans City counters with 13 hp at 120 kg.
